Hmmmm.....lower A arm......I have some rally A arms that are boxed in ready to be installed, but was waiting until later.
Since I don't have X ray vision, but an X rated mind, I am thinking that my aftermarket supplier in a rush gave me a pressure plate that did not have the Saab heat treat on the face of the pressure plate. I recall that after the first 1000 miles, I took it apart to reset the pilot bearing, and noticed that the PP had a .050 deep groove the width of the pucks worn in it by the hockey pucks. So, maybe they gouged into the PP and............well heck, then it should do it in first too.
I guess the only way to tell is to change the dirty mind for dirty hands.
